We are working with a thriving Legal 500, regional practice seeking a talented Private Family Partner to join their newly opened Stoke-on-Trent office. As part of a highly regarded family law team, you’ll advise individuals and families across the UK on a broad range of private family law matters, including UHNW / HNW divorce, financial settlements, children arrangements, international cases, succession planning, pre-nuptial agreements, and domestic abuse protection. You’ll benefit from a steady flow of quality instructions and a supportive, collaborative environment.
